•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Kod hatası

Katılım
26 Eylül 2020
Mesajlar
171
Excel Vers. ve Dili
excel 2019 pro.Türkçe
Aşağıdaki kod ile listboxdaki verilerin toplamını alıyordum fakat benzer çalışmayı farklı bir sayfada yapmak istediğimde 3.satır hata veriyor burada "Val" değeri yerine başka ne yazılabilir.Niye hata veriyor anlamakta zorlanıyorum. yardımcı olursanız sevinirim.


Dim i As Long, t1 As Double
For i = 0 To Sheets("Anasayfa").ListBox3.ListCount - 1
topla = topla + Val(ListBox3.List(i, 5))
Sheets("Anasayfa").TextBox8.Value = topla
Sheets("Anasayfa").TextBox8 = Format(Sheets("Anasayfa").TextBox8, vbCrLf & "#,##0 TL")
Next i
 
Son düzenleme:
Bu tarz hatalar genelde nokta-virgül karmaşasından kaynaklanır.

Excel sayfasında genellikle ondalık ayıraç virgül olarak kullanılırken VBA tarafında nokta olmalıdır.

Val yerine CDbl deneyiniz.
 
Geri
Üst